Executive Council Positions
All positions on the Executive Council are up for election. These include
- President
- Vice President
- Secretary
- Director of Social Affairs
- Director of Finance
- Director of Facilities
- Director of Women's Affairs
- Director of Education
- Director of Communications
- Director of Community Welfare
- Director of Youth and Students
Each member of the Executive Council shall be elected to serve a term of two years.

Eligibility to contest for a position
- Those who have been a member for at least 1 year are eligible to be nominated and contest the election.

Verification of nominations and finalizing ballot.
- Only CVIC members can do the nominations; nominators will be verified by the election committee to be CVIC members
- Only those who have been members for at least 1 year will be eligible to contest the election, the nominating committee will verify the status of nominated members
- Starting November 11, election committee will reach out to the members that have been nominated; the nominee will have the choice to accept or decline the nomination within 3 days of initial notification by the election committee.
- If the member has been nominated for multiple executive council positions, they can accept the nomination for only one position.
- After all nominees have been contacted, and have indicated their acceptance/decline of the nomination, a list of nominees that have accepted the nomination will be on the final ballot,
- The final slate of candidates that are on the ballot will be provided to the members on November 15.

In Person elections
- Elections will be conducted in person at the CVIC building from 2PM to 5PM on Saturday 12/7/2024.
- Paper ballots, and instructions to the members in completing the ballot will be provided.
- After completion of the election at 5:00 PM, members of the election committee will count the votes (both in person and absentee votes) in a confidential fashion.
- All members of the Election Committee will sign off on the final result, and the chair shall announce the results immediately after the count.
- Tally totals can be shared with any nominee at their request, after the election is completed.
- According to the CVIC bylaws, any dispute relating to elections shall be raised at the meeting at which the elections are held and shall be addressed immediately at such meeting by the Chairman of the Election Committee, whose decision in the matter shall be final and binding.
